你查询的IP:[124.220.86.227]  地理位置:中国–上海–上海

最新查询121.59.11.156 123.253.100.235 60.208.250.199 221.192.232.160 121.16.104.70 117.22.55.187 116.215.46.26 124.31.38.145 59.107.99.220 124.220.86.227 202.22.248.141 222.248.206.164 119.84.185.186 218.126.106.184 119.15.136.231 118.242.108.250 118.239.65.160 59.80.186.198 203.158.16.173 203.212.80.0 123.244.121.236 119.40.64.114 202.14.238.74 123.232.53.89 116.207.152.186 202.149.224.34 124.16.107.141 202.14.235.239 58.82.22.252 121.52.160.191 202.181.112.116